#8f77dc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8f77dc is composed of 56.1% red, 46.7%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35% cyan, 45.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 254.3 degrees, a saturation of 59.1% and a lightness of 66.5%. #8f77dc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eeff with #1f00b9.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#8f77dc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020104 is the darkest color, while #f6f4f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#8f77dc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7a5ae is the less saturated color, while #7e56fd is the most saturated one.
